Russia heavily bombed kyiv this Sunday and at least four people dieddays after a Ukrainian attack on a high school in a region occupied by Moscow that Russian President Vladimir Putin vowed to avenge.

Ukraine detected “690 air attack devices: 90 missiles and 600 drones of different types”indicated the air force, which also reported “an intermediate-range ballistic missile.” This is one of the most intense bombings against the city since the start of the Russian invasion four years ago,

According to the mayor of kyiv, Vitali Klitschko, two people died in the capital and 56 were injured. The leader of the kyiv region stated that two people had died in that area, where nine injuries were also reported.

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ky confirmed that the Russian regime launched an Oreshnik hypersonic missilewith nuclear capacity.

“Three Russian missiles against a water supply facility, a market burned, dozens of residential buildings damaged, several schools,” Zelensky denounced on Telegram. “They are completely crazy,” he said.
